Rehabilitation

Many clients are referred to our studio by the medical profession for Pilates exercises and for rehabilitation.

Patients with back pain are given exercises to strengthen their core and back muscles to better protect their backs and hopefully eliminate their need for surgery. We elongate the spine to decompress the vertebrae and we work in all the ranges of spinal movement in order to nourish the discs, joints and muscles surrounding the spine. With fresh nutrients and blood, healing is enhanced and accelerated. We work on flexibility of the spine and on strengthening from the inside out; from the core, including the pelvic floor, to the superficial musculature. These exercise programmes are created individually to cater to each patient’s needs and specific injury or surgery.

We assist with rehabilitation for a wide range of injuries including:

  • Scoliosis, shoulder injuries and rotator cuff injuries;
  • Post operative spinal surgery;
  • Degeneration of discs to vertebrae replacements;
  • Fusions and stents in the spine.
  • pubis symphysis derangement, c-section, and diastasis recti.
  • Hip and knee replacements. 
  • Ankle and foot injuries.

We also work with patients with high cholesterol and hypertensive clients; clients who have had heart surgery; asthmatics, client who are obese, and those with osteoporosis. The reformer offers resistance during exercises that stimulate the bones and this can stem the progression of osteoporosis.
